Smart Motorcycle Helmets Market Outlook
The global Smart Motorcycle Helmets market is projected to reach approximately USD 2.5 billion by 2033, growing at a compound annual growth rate (CAGR) of around 15% from 2025 to 2033. This significant growth is largely driven by the rising demand for advanced safety features and enhanced connectivity in motorcycling gear. As the motorcycle industry evolves, manufacturers are increasingly integrating smart technologies into helmets, resulting in improved rider safety and convenience. Furthermore, the growing popularity of motorcycling as a leisure activity and the demand for smart wearable devices are further fueling market expansion. The trend toward urban mobility solutions and the increasing focus on road safety regulations are also contributing factors that bode well for the future of smart motorcycle helmets.

By Product Type
Full Face Helmet:
Full face helmets represent one of the most popular product types in the Smart Motorcycle Helmets market, providing comprehensive protection for riders. These helmets cover the entire head, including the jaw and chin areas, offering superior safety as they reduce the risk of injuries during accidents. The integration of smart technology in full face helmets, such as built-in Bluetooth speakers and noise cancellation features, enhances the riding experience. Moreover, leading manufacturers are continuously innovating to incorporate additional functionalities, including rear-view cameras and heads-up displays, making these helmets highly desirable for both casual and professional riders. The growing emphasis on safety and comfort during long rides has led to an increased adoption of full face helmets, solidifying their position in the market.
Half Face Helmet:
Half face helmets are gaining popularity among urban riders due to their lightweight design and excellent ventilation. These helmets cover only the top and back of the head, providing a more open riding experience. The integration of smart features, such as Bluetooth connectivity for hands-free communication and navigation, has made half face helmets a preferred choice for city commuters. They are often favored for short rides due to their comfort and ease of use. However, the challenge remains in maintaining adequate safety standards compared to full face helmets. As a result, manufacturers are focusing on enhancing the protective features while still retaining the style and convenience associated with half face designs. The growing trend of personalized helmets with customizable colors and designs is further fueling the half face helmet segment.
Modular Helmet:
Modular helmets offer the unique advantage of being versatile, combining the features of both full face and open face helmets. This adaptability makes them highly appealing to riders who value flexibility. Smart technologies in modular helmets are evolving rapidly, with options for integrated communication systems and enhanced visibility features. Riders appreciate the ability to flip up the front of the helmet for easy interaction without removing it entirely, making modular helmets particularly popular for touring and adventure segments. As consumer preferences continue to evolve towards helmets that can serve multiple purposes, the demand for modular helmets is expected to grow significantly. Manufacturers are also leveraging advanced materials and designs to enhance safety and comfort, further positioning modular helmets as a popular choice in the market.
Off-Road Helmet:
Off-road helmets are specifically designed for riders who engage in motocross and trail riding, providing enhanced protection against impacts and debris. The smart motorcycle helmet segment has seen innovations such as integrated communication systems and advanced ventilation technologies tailored for off-road conditions. These helmets often come with a lightweight design, allowing riders to maneuver easily during their activities. As off-road biking continues to gain popularity, especially in regions with vast outdoor spaces, the demand for off-road helmets that incorporate smart technologies is also on the rise. Manufacturers are increasingly focusing on durability, comfort, and safety features to cater to the unique needs of off-road enthusiasts. The incorporation of smart technology that enhances connectivity and safety has also become a focal point for this segment.
Dual Sport Helmet:
Dual sport helmets cater to riders who enjoy both on-road and off-road riding, offering the versatility needed for various conditions. These helmets are designed with a hybrid approach, providing the safety features of full face helmets while maintaining the comfort of open face designs. The integration of smart technology in dual sport helmets is becoming more prevalent, with features like integrated GPS and communication systems that are particularly beneficial for long-distance rides. As the adventure motorcycling segment continues to grow, the demand for dual sport helmets with smart functionalities is likely to increase. Manufacturers are focused on developing helmets that can withstand diverse riding conditions while providing advanced connectivity options, making dual sport helmets an appealing choice for a wide range of riders.

By Connectivity Type
Bluetooth:
Bluetooth connectivity is one of the most sought-after features in smart motorcycle helmets, offering riders the ability to connect their devices seamlessly. This technology enables hands-free communication, allowing riders to receive calls and listen to music without taking their focus off the road. Bluetooth-integrated helmets often come with companion apps that provide additional functionalities, such as navigation prompts and rider-to-rider communication. As the demand for connected devices continues to rise, manufacturers are prioritizing Bluetooth technology in their helmet designs. The growing trend of smart gear in the motorcycling community further drives the adoption of Bluetooth-enabled helmets.
Wi-Fi:
Wi-Fi connectivity in smart motorcycle helmets allows for more robust features, including real-time updates and software enhancements. This feature enables riders to connect their helmets to the internet, accessing navigation maps and receiving live traffic updates as they ride. Although not as common as Bluetooth, Wi-Fi connectivity offers significant advantages, particularly for touring and adventure riders who require constant access to data while on the road. The ability to connect to Wi-Fi networks further enhances the functionality of smart helmets, providing a competitive edge for manufacturers that incorporate this technology into their products. As users become more reliant on connectivity, the demand for Wi-Fi-enabled helmets is likely to increase.
GPS:
GPS technology is becoming a critical feature in smart motorcycle helmets, especially for riders who enjoy touring and adventure biking. Integrated GPS systems allow for real-time location tracking and navigation, providing riders with turn-by-turn directions directly within their helmets. This hands-free experience enhances safety, as riders can stay focused on the road while navigating unfamiliar routes. Manufacturers are increasingly incorporating advanced GPS functionalities, such as route optimization and points of interest, to appeal to adventurous riders. With the growing popularity of motorcycle touring and exploration, the demand for helmets equipped with GPS technology is on the rise.
HUD:
Heads-Up Display (HUD) technology in smart motorcycle helmets offers riders an innovative way to access information without taking their eyes off the road. HUD systems project key data, such as speed, navigation cues, and communication alerts, onto a transparent visor or screen. This feature enables riders to stay informed while maintaining their focus on the road ahead. As manufacturers continue to explore HUD technology, the potential for further advancements within this segment is enormous. The increasing emphasis on rider safety and the demand for advanced features are driving the adoption of HUD-equipped helmets, making them a game-changing innovation in the smart motorcycle helmet market.
Others:
The 'Others' connectivity type segment encompasses various emerging technologies that enhance the functionality of smart motorcycle helmets. This may include features such as advanced sensor systems for crash detection, integrated cameras for recording rides, or augmented reality applications. As the smart helmet market continues to evolve, manufacturers are exploring new technologies that can provide additional safety and convenience to riders. The rise of wearable technology is also influencing this segment, encouraging innovation and the development of multi-functional smart helmets that cater to diverse rider needs. As consumer preferences shift towards more advanced features, the 'Others' segment is expected to grow as manufacturers innovate to meet these demands.
By Region
North America is currently the largest market for smart motorcycle helmets, accounting for approximately 35% of the global market share. The region's strong motorcycle culture, along with increasing awareness of safety and technological advancements, are key factors driving this growth. The U.S. and Canada are home to numerous riders who are increasingly adopting smart helmets equipped with the latest technologies, leading to a robust demand in this segment. The market is projected to grow at a CAGR of 14% from 2025 to 2033, indicating a healthy upward trend as more riders recognize the advantages of these innovative helmets.
In Europe, the smart motorcycle helmet market is also experiencing significant growth, driven by a strong emphasis on safety and regulatory compliance. Countries like Germany, France, and Italy are witnessing rising demand as more riders seek helmets that integrate advanced features such as Bluetooth connectivity and GPS. The European market is anticipated to grow steadily, with a CAGR of around 13% over the forecast period. Additionally, the increasing popularity of recreational riding and motorcycle tourism in the region is contributing to market expansion. Other regions such as Asia Pacific and Latin America are also expected to witness growth, albeit at a slower pace due to varying levels of motorcycle penetration and consumer awareness.

Threats
The Smart Motorcycle Helmets market faces several potential threats that could impact growth and innovation. One of the primary concerns is the high cost associated with producing advanced smart helmets, which may deter budget-conscious consumers. As manufacturers invest in high-quality materials and cutting-edge technology, the resulting price increases could limit market penetration among cost-sensitive riders. Additionally, the competition in the market is intensifying, with numerous manufacturers vying for market share. This escalating competition can lead to pricing pressures, affecting profitability for established brands. Furthermore, regulatory challenges surrounding safety standards and certifications could pose barriers to entry for new players in the market, hindering innovation and growth.
Another significant threat comes from consumer skepticism regarding smart technologies in helmets. Many traditional motorcyclists may be resistant to adopting smart features, perceiving them as unnecessary or overly complicated. Changing these perceptions can be a considerable challenge for manufacturers as they work to educate consumers about the benefits of smart helmets. Moreover, potential data privacy concerns regarding the connectivity features in smart helmets may also deter some consumers from embracing these technologies. Addressing these concerns through transparent communication and robust data protection measures will be vital for manufacturers seeking to gain consumer trust and drive market growth.
